ADAI - Association for the Development of Industrial Aerodynamics is a non-profit association that promotes research, development, training and services in the domain of Industrial Aerodynamics.

ADAI was created in 1990 by a group of researchers in the areas of Fluid Mechanics, Heat Transmission and Air Conditioning and Environment, from the Department of Mechanical Engineering (DEM) of the Faculty of Science and Technology of the University of Coimbra (FCT-UC), with the aim of providing a formal framework for the promotion of research activity and experimental development within those units, in collaboration with various public and private entities.

Since October 9th 2006 ADAI became part of the Associated Laboratory on Energy, Transportation and Aeronautics (LAETA).

SETsa – Simultaneous Engineering Technology, S.A., a company of the IBEROMOLDES Group founded in 1989, is a benchmark in engineering services and value-added products that has been operating in highly demanding areas of industrial activity, such as the automotive, aerospace and medical devices sectors.

SETsa offers integrated solutions ranging from product design and engineering, through moulds and tooling, to the production and supply of complete systems and functional components in the most varied thermoplastics and metals.

SETsa support the full supply chain, providing our clients with solutions that turns their product ideas into mass production products ready to market.
